   A Celt's New Dance         by Gary Roodman                1996 
           4 couples, square formation 
   Part I
   Part        Bars        Description
   A1        4        Join hands. All in a double and out
           4        Face partner and do two changes of grand chain
                   Reform the set with original opposite as partner 
   A2        8        All that again to original place, with new partner
   B1        2        With partner, Turn by the right 3/4 until womem are in the center
           4        Women star left once
                   while men walk CW halfway around outside
           2        Meet opposite, turn by the right hand halfway so men are in center
   B2        4        Men star left once around
                   while women walk CW around outside
           4        Meet partner and turn by the right halfway into home positions.
   Part II
   Part        Bars        Description
   A1        4        Side with partner 
           4        Two changes of grand chain, starting partner by right hand 
   A2        4        Side with new partner (original opposite) 
           4        Two changes of grand chain
                   End with original partner in opposite places 
   B1        2        Head couples lead in to middle
           2        Heads change hands & lead out
                   while sides lead into middle 
           2        Heads cast to side positions
                   while sides meet opposites & lead out to nearest head positions 
           2        All 2 hand turn opposites
   B2        8        All that again, with heads & sides reversing roles
                   All end in original places
   Part III
   Part        Bars        Description
   A1        4        Partners arm right & fall back
           4        Two changes of grand chain, starting partner by right hand 
   A2        8        All that again from new positions
                   End near partner in lines along the sides, facing in
                   (Original sides are in center of lines, heads at ends)
   B1        2        Lines fall back 
           2        All turn single
           4        Lines come forward, cross through passing right shoulders
                   reform into lines at heads, facing in
                   (Ends cross with half-gypsy and move in
                   while middles move out to join ends of new lines)
   B2        4        Lines fall back & all turn single.
           4        Lines come forward, cross through passing right shoulders
                   Reform the set into a square with original partner in home postion
